How they compare
Liechtenstein currently reports 1.2 against 1.12 in Sweden, a difference of 0.08.
That makes Liechtenstein's figure about 1.1 times Sweden's.
The two have swapped places 3 times across 13 shared years of data; in 2012 it was Sweden ahead.
Liechtenstein ranks 12th and Sweden ranks 15th of 29 countries.
Across the 2 decades both report, Liechtenstein averaged higher in 1 and Sweden in 1.
